用python的while嵌套解决百钱百鸡问题

茗越

关注

阅读 56

2022-05-04

已知公鸡每只5元,母鸡每只3元,小鸡每3只1元。现在要100元买100只鸡,公鸡、母鸡和小鸡分别多少只?

a = 0
while a <= 20:
    b = 0
    while b <= 33:
        c = 100 - a - b
        if (a * 5 + b * 3 + c / 3) == 100:
            print(a, b, c)
        b += 1
    a += 1

 在python解决百钱百鸡问题以上就可以解决。

精彩评论(0)

0 0 举报